Description

A RARE AND EXCEPTIONAL RESIDENTIAL AND AMENITY ESTATE SET IN THE ROLLING COUNTRYSIDE OF THE EYE BROOK VALLEY ON THE RUTLAND/LEICESTERSHIRE BORDER

Description

The Allexton Hall Estate sits in beautiful rolling countryside on the Rutland/Leicestershire border and only 4 miles from the market town of Uppingham with its renowned public school.

There is an impressive Grade II listed Hall, a pair of Gate lodges, three properties in the former Stable Yard, a farmhouse in the middle of the Estate, renowned equestrian facilities, further farm buildings, extensive mature landscaped gardens and parkland planted for year round colour and interest.

The Estate totals 954.50 acres (386.21 hectares) and includes approximately 794 acres (321 hectares) of productive arable farmland, 94 acres of pastureland (38 hectares) and 49 acres (20 hectares) of mature woodland, all set within the rolling countryside of the Eye Brook Valley which offers significant amenity and sporting appeal.

Location

Allexton Hall sits to the west of the village of Allexton, surrounded by undulating parkland and extensive landscaped gardens with far reaching views over the gardens and park to the south and gardens to the east and west and lakes to the north. The Hall is approached via two lime tree-lined driveways, the principal drive from the north, with the entrance flanked by two gate lodges, and the secondary drive to the east from Allexton village.

The village of Allexton is situated approximately 4 miles west of the market town of Uppingham, home of the renowned public school. The town includes a wide range of amenities including a hotel, a number of well-regarded restaurants and shopping.

Market Harborough lies 13 miles to the south and has a mainline station providing a fast service to London St Pancras from 59 minutes, whilst the city of Leicester to the west is easily accessed by the A47.

Rutland Water is nearby and includes facilities for a wide range of leisure activities including water sports, cycling, fishing and golf. The village of Hambleton sits on the Hambleton peninsula and includes the renowned Hambleton Hall Hotel. There are a number of leading private schools in the area as well as, Uppingham including Oakham, Oundle, Stamford and Rugby.
